  • @RaGeInsomniac 5/4 just means that you are playing 5 beats in one measure and a qaurter note gets 1 beat (5 quarter notes per measure).  In common time (4/4) you would count 4 beats and then a new measure would start. in 5/4 you count to 5. for example if you do a basic 1 measure 16th note fill in 4/4 time, you would count 1-e-&-a, 2-e-&-a, 3-e-&-a, 4-e-&-a. If you want to do a 1 measure 16th note fill in 5/4 you would count: 1-e-&-a, 2-e-&-a, 3-e-&-a, 4-e-&-a, 5-e-&-a.

  • People have been asking about the cost - I recently bought the same set in Cherry Red stain. Without the side snare and additional floor Tom it cost £1600 but the price has just gone up to £1800. The additional snare is another £250 and the floor around £350. So the shell pack on it's own will set you back around £2400. Also there is a 5 - 6 month wait due to the backlog of orders.
